657c478bd9Sstevel@tonic-gate /*
66de777a60Sab196087  * Buffer types:
675aefb655Srie  *
68de777a60Sab196087  * Many of the routines in this module require the user to supply a
69de777a60Sab196087  * buffer into which the desired strings may be written. These are
70de777a60Sab196087  * all arrays of characters, and might be defined as simple arrays
71de777a60Sab196087  * of char. The problem with that approach is that when such an array
72de777a60Sab196087  * is passed to a function, the C language considers it to have the
73de777a60Sab196087  * type (char *), without any regard to its length. Not all of our
74de777a60Sab196087  * buffers have the same length, and we want to ensure that the compiler
75de777a60Sab196087  * will refuse to compile code that passes the wrong type of buffer to
76de777a60Sab196087  * a given routine. The solution is to define the buffers as unions
77de777a60Sab196087  * that contain the needed array, and then to pass the given union
78de777a60Sab196087  * by address. The compiler will catch attempts to pass the wrong type
79de777a60Sab196087  * of pointer, and the size of a structure/union is implicit in its type.
80de777a60Sab196087  *
81de777a60Sab196087  * A nice side effect of this approach is that we can use a union with
82de777a60Sab196087  * multiple buffers to handle the cases where a given routine needs
83de777a60Sab196087  * more than one type of buffer. The end result is a single buffer large
84de777a60Sab196087  * enough to handle any of the subcases, but no larger.
855aefb655Srie  */
865aefb655Srie 
875aefb655Srie /*
88de777a60Sab196087  * Size of buffer used by conv_invalid_val():
89de777a60Sab196087  *
90de777a60Sab196087  * Various values that can't be matched to a symbolic definition are converted
91de777a60Sab196087  * to a numeric string.
92de777a60Sab196087  *
93de777a60Sab196087  * The buffer size reflects the maximum number of digits needed to
94de777a60Sab196087  * display an integer as text, plus a trailing null, and with room for
95de777a60Sab196087  * a leading "0x" if hexidecimal display is selected.
962926dd2eSrie  */
97de777a60Sab196087 #define	CONV32_INV_BUFSIZE	12
98de777a60Sab196087 typedef union {
99de777a60Sab196087 	char			buf[CONV32_INV_BUFSIZE];
100de777a60Sab196087 } Conv32_inv_buf_t;
101de777a60Sab196087 
102de777a60Sab196087 #define	CONV64_INV_BUFSIZE	22
103de777a60Sab196087 typedef union {
104de777a60Sab196087 	char			buf[CONV64_INV_BUFSIZE];
105de777a60Sab196087 } Conv64_inv_buf_t;

5352926dd2eSrie /*
536d29b2c44Sab196087  * Many conversion routines accept a fmt_flags argument of this type
537d29b2c44Sab196087  * to allow the caller to modify the output. There are two parts to
538d29b2c44Sab196087  * this value:
539d29b2c44Sab196087  *
540d29b2c44Sab196087  *	(1) Format requests (decimal vs hex, etc...)
541d29b2c44Sab196087  *	(2) The low order bits specified by CONV_MASK_FMT_ALT
542d29b2c44Sab196087  *		and retrieved by CONV_TYPE_FMT_ALT are integer
543d29b2c44Sab196087  *		values that specify that an alternate set of
544d29b2c44Sab196087  *		strings should be used. This is necessary because
545d29b2c44Sab196087  *		different utilities evolved to use different strings,
546d29b2c44Sab196087  *		and there are backward compatability guarantees in
547d29b2c44Sab196087  *		place that prevent changing them.
548d29b2c44Sab196087  *
549d29b2c44Sab196087  * These values are designed such that a caller can always supply a
550d29b2c44Sab196087  * simple 0 in order to receive "default" behavior.
5515aefb655Srie  */
552d29b2c44Sab196087 typedef int Conv_fmt_flags_t;
553c13de8f6Sab196087 
554c13de8f6Sab196087 /*
555d29b2c44Sab196087  * The bottom 8 bits of Conv_fmt_flags_t are used to encode
556d29b2c44Sab196087  * alternative strings.
557d29b2c44Sab196087  *
558d29b2c44Sab196087  * If a given conversion routine does not support alternative strings
559d29b2c44Sab196087  * for a given CONV_FMT_ALT type, it silently ignores the request and
560d29b2c44Sab196087  * supplies the default set. This means that a utility like dump(1) is
561d29b2c44Sab196087  * free to specify its special type in every conversion routine call,
562d29b2c44Sab196087  * without regard to whether it has any special meaning for that particular
563d29b2c44Sab196087  * routine. It will receive its special strings if there are any, and
564d29b2c44Sab196087  * the defaults otherwise.
565c13de8f6Sab196087  */
566d29b2c44Sab196087 #define	CONV_MASK_FMT_ALT		0xff
567d29b2c44Sab196087 #define	CONV_TYPE_FMT_ALT(fmt_flags)	(fmt_flags & CONV_MASK_FMT_ALT)
568d29b2c44Sab196087 
569d29b2c44Sab196087 #define	CONV_FMT_ALT_DEFAULT	0	/* "Standard" strings */
570d29b2c44Sab196087 #define	CONV_FMT_ALT_DUMP	1	/* Style of strings used by dump(1) */
571d29b2c44Sab196087 #define	CONV_FMT_ALT_FILE	2	/* Style of strings used by file(1) */
572d29b2c44Sab196087 #define	CONV_FMT_ALT_CRLE	3	/* Style of strings used by crle(1) */
573d29b2c44Sab196087 #define	CONV_FMT_ALT_FULLNAME	4	/* Strings should be full #define */
574d29b2c44Sab196087 					/* 	(e.g. STB_LOCAL, not LOCL) */
575d29b2c44Sab196087 
576d29b2c44Sab196087 /*
577d29b2c44Sab196087  * Flags that alter standard formatting for conversion routines.
578d29b2c44Sab196087  * These bits start after the range occupied by CONV_MASK_FMT_ALT.
579d29b2c44Sab196087  */
580d29b2c44Sab196087 #define	CONV_FMT_DECIMAL	0x0100	/* conv_invalid_val() should print */
581d29b2c44Sab196087 					/*    integer print as decimal */
582d29b2c44Sab196087 					/*    (default is hex) */
583d29b2c44Sab196087 #define	CONV_FMT_SPACE		0x0200	/* conv_invalid_val() should append */
584d29b2c44Sab196087 					/*    a space after the number.  */
585d29b2c44Sab196087 #define	CONV_FMT_NOBKT		0x0400	/* conv_expn_field() should omit */
586d29b2c44Sab196087 					/*    prefix and suffix strings */
587d29b2c44Sab196087

5895aefb655Srie /*
5905aefb655Srie  * The expansion of bit-field data items is driven from a value descriptor and
5915aefb655Srie  * the conv_expn_field() routine.
5925aefb655Srie  */
5935aefb655Srie typedef struct {
5945aefb655Srie 	Xword		v_val;		/* expansion value */
5955aefb655Srie 	const char	*v_msg;		/* associated message string */
5965aefb655Srie } Val_desc;
5975aefb655Srie 
5985aefb655Srie /*
599ba4e3c84Sab196087  * conv_expn_field() is willing to supply default strings for the
600ba4e3c84Sab196087  * prefix, separator, and suffix arguments, if they are passed as NULL.
601ba4e3c84Sab196087  * The caller needs to know how much room to allow for these items.
602ba4e3c84Sab196087  * These values supply those sizes.
603ba4e3c84Sab196087  */
604ba4e3c84Sab196087 #define	CONV_EXPN_FIELD_DEF_PREFIX_SIZE	2	/* Default is "[ " */
605ba4e3c84Sab196087 #define	CONV_EXPN_FIELD_DEF_SEP_SIZE	1	/* Default is " " */
606ba4e3c84Sab196087 #define	CONV_EXPN_FIELD_DEF_SUFFIX_SIZE	2	/* Default is " ]" */
607ba4e3c84Sab196087 
608ba4e3c84Sab196087 /*
609ba4e3c84Sab196087  * conv_expn_field() requires a large number of inputs, many of which
610ba4e3c84Sab196087  * can be NULL to accept default behavior. An argument of the following
611ba4e3c84Sab196087  * type is used to supply them.
612ba4e3c84Sab196087  */
613ba4e3c84Sab196087 typedef struct {
614ba4e3c84Sab196087 	char *buf;		/* Buffer to receive generated string */
615ba4e3c84Sab196087 	size_t bufsize;		/* sizeof(buf) */
616ba4e3c84Sab196087 	const Val_desc *vdp;	/* Array of value descriptors, giving the */
617ba4e3c84Sab196087 				/*	possible bit values, and their */
618ba4e3c84Sab196087 				/*	corresponding strings. Note that the */
619ba4e3c84Sab196087 				/*	final element must contain only NULL */
620ba4e3c84Sab196087 				/*	values. This terminates the list. */
621ba4e3c84Sab196087 	const char **lead_str;	/* NULL, or array of pointers to strings to */
622ba4e3c84Sab196087 				/*	be output at the head of the list. */
623ba4e3c84Sab196087 				/*	Last entry must be NULL. */
624ba4e3c84Sab196087 	Xword oflags;		/* Bits for which output strings are desired */
625ba4e3c84Sab196087 	Xword rflags;		/* Bits for which a numeric value should be */
626ba4e3c84Sab196087 				/*	output if vdp does not provide str. */
627ba4e3c84Sab196087 				/*	Must be a proper subset of oflags */
628ba4e3c84Sab196087 	const char *prefix;	/* NULL, or string to prefix output with */
629ba4e3c84Sab196087 				/*	If NULL, "[ " is used. */
630ba4e3c84Sab196087 	const char *sep;	/* NULL, or string to separate output items */
631ba4e3c84Sab196087 				/*	with. If NULL, " " is used. */
632ba4e3c84Sab196087 	const char *suffix;	/* NULL, or string to suffix output with */
633ba4e3c84Sab196087 				/*	If NULL, " ]" is used. */
634ba4e3c84Sab196087 } CONV_EXPN_FIELD_ARG;
